/openssl/providers/implementations/ciphers/ |
H A D | cipher_aes_gcm_siv.h | 27 size_t len); 39 size_t aad_len; /* actual AAD length */ 40 size_t key_len; 56 const PROV_CIPHER_HW_AES_GCM_SIV *ossl_prov_cipher_hw_aes_gcm_siv(size_t keybits); 59 void ossl_polyval_ghash_hash(const u128 Htable[16], uint8_t *tag, const uint8_t *inp, size_t len);
|
H A D | cipher_aes_gcm_siv_hw.c | 30 size_t i; in aes_gcm_siv_initkey() 108 const unsigned char *aad, size_t len) in aes_gcm_siv_aad() 110 size_t to_alloc; in aes_gcm_siv_aad() 149 unsigned char *out, size_t len) in aes_gcm_siv_encrypt() 155 size_t i; in aes_gcm_siv_encrypt() 210 unsigned char *out, size_t len) in aes_gcm_siv_decrypt() 215 size_t i; in aes_gcm_siv_decrypt() 275 const unsigned char *in, size_t len) in aes_gcm_siv_cipher() 339 size_t i; in aes_gcm_siv_ctr32() 340 size_t j; in aes_gcm_siv_ctr32() [all …]
|
H A D | cipher_aes_gcm_hw.c | 21 size_t keylen) in aes_gcm_initkey() 62 size_t len, unsigned char *out) in generic_aes_gcm_cipher_update() 67 size_t bulk = 0; in generic_aes_gcm_cipher_update() 70 size_t res = (16 - ctx->gcm.mres) % 16; in generic_aes_gcm_cipher_update() 96 size_t bulk = 0; in generic_aes_gcm_cipher_update() 99 size_t res = (16 - ctx->gcm.mres) % 16; in generic_aes_gcm_cipher_update() 150 const PROV_GCM_HW *ossl_prov_aes_hw_gcm(size_t keybits) in ossl_prov_aes_hw_gcm()
|
H A D | cipher_aes_cbc_hmac_sha.c | 49 static int aes_einit(void *ctx, const unsigned char *key, size_t keylen, in aes_einit() 50 const unsigned char *iv, size_t ivlen, in aes_einit() 58 static int aes_dinit(void *ctx, const unsigned char *key, size_t keylen, in aes_dinit() 59 const unsigned char *iv, size_t ivlen, in aes_dinit() 186 size_t keylen; in aes_set_ctx_params() 230 size_t len = hw->tls1_multiblock_max_bufsize(ctx); in aes_get_ctx_params() 311 size_t kbits, size_t blkbits, size_t ivbits, in base_init() 320 static void *aes_cbc_hmac_sha1_newctx(void *provctx, size_t kbits, in aes_cbc_hmac_sha1_newctx() 321 size_t blkbits, size_t ivbits, in aes_cbc_hmac_sha1_newctx() 357 static void *aes_cbc_hmac_sha256_newctx(void *provctx, size_t kbits, in aes_cbc_hmac_sha256_newctx() [all …]
|
H A D | cipher_aes_gcm_siv.c | 27 static void *ossl_aes_gcm_siv_newctx(void *provctx, size_t keybits) in ossl_aes_gcm_siv_newctx() 91 static int ossl_aes_gcm_siv_init(void *vctx, const unsigned char *key, size_t keylen, in ossl_aes_gcm_siv_init() 92 const unsigned char *iv, size_t ivlen, in ossl_aes_gcm_siv_init() 123 static int ossl_aes_gcm_siv_einit(void *vctx, const unsigned char *key, size_t keylen, in ossl_aes_gcm_siv_einit() 124 const unsigned char *iv, size_t ivlen, in ossl_aes_gcm_siv_einit() 130 static int ossl_aes_gcm_siv_dinit(void *vctx, const unsigned char *key, size_t keylen, in ossl_aes_gcm_siv_dinit() 131 const unsigned char *iv, size_t ivlen, in ossl_aes_gcm_siv_dinit() 138 static int ossl_aes_gcm_siv_cipher(void *vctx, unsigned char *out, size_t *outl, in ossl_aes_gcm_siv_cipher() 139 size_t outsize, const unsigned char *in, size_t inl) in ossl_aes_gcm_siv_cipher() 167 size_t outsize) in ossl_aes_gcm_siv_stream_final() [all …]
|
/openssl/ssl/record/methods/ |
H A D | tls13_meth.c | 18 unsigned char *iv, size_t ivlen, in tls13_set_crypto_state() 21 size_t taglen, in tls13_set_crypto_state() 87 size_t macsize) in tls13_cipher() 92 size_t nonce_len, offset, loop, hdrlen, taglen; in tls13_cipher() 141 nonce_len = (size_t)ivlen; in tls13_cipher() 235 || (size_t)(lenu + lenf) != rec->length) { in tls13_cipher() 279 size_t end; in tls13_post_process_record() 328 size_t rlen; in tls13_add_record_padding() 343 size_t padding = 0; in tls13_add_record_padding() 344 size_t max_padding = rl->max_frag_len - rlen; in tls13_add_record_padding() [all …]
|
/openssl/providers/implementations/rands/seeding/ |
H A D | rand_win.c | 47 size_t ossl_pool_acquire_entropy(RAND_POOL *pool) in ossl_pool_acquire_entropy() 53 size_t bytes_needed; in ossl_pool_acquire_entropy() 54 size_t entropy_available = 0; in ossl_pool_acquire_entropy() 73 size_t bytes = 0; in ossl_pool_acquire_entropy() 87 size_t bytes = 0; in ossl_pool_acquire_entropy() 106 size_t bytes = 0; in ossl_pool_acquire_entropy()
|
/openssl/test/ |
H A D | acvp_test.c | 99 size_t sig_len; in sig_gen() 233 size_t *rlen, size_t *slen) in get_ecdsa_sig_rs_bytes() 237 size_t r1_len, s1_len; in get_ecdsa_sig_rs_bytes() 306 size_t sig_len; in ecdsa_sigver_test() 352 size_t len = 0; in pkey_get_octet_bytes() 682 size_t *r_len, size_t *s_len) in get_dsa_sig_rs_bytes() 686 size_t r1_len, s1_len; in get_dsa_sig_rs_bytes() 756 size_t sig_len; in dsa_sigver_test() 1243 size_t n_len = 0, d_len = 0; in rsa_keygen_test() 1440 size_t pt_len = sizeof(pt); in rsa_decryption_primitive_test() [all …]
|
H A D | params_api_test.c | 23 size_t j; in swap_copy() 38 const void *in, size_t inlen) in le_copy() 52 size_t len; 117 size_t width) in test_param_type_extra() 121 size_t s, sz; in test_param_type_extra() 165 if (sizeof(size_t) > width) { in test_param_type_extra() 436 size_t in, out; in test_param_size_t() 438 const size_t len = raw_values[n].len >= sizeof(size_t) in test_param_size_t() 497 const size_t len = raw_values[n].len; in test_param_bignum() 532 const size_t len = raw_values[n].len; in test_param_signed_bignum() [all …]
|
H A D | evp_test.c | 353 size_t buflen; 354 size_t count; 472 size_t j; in evp_test_buffer_do() 491 size_t i; in unescape() 583 size_t vlen; in parse_bin_chunk() 1363 size_t current_in_len = (size_t) data_chunk_size; in cipher_test_enc() 1818 size_t current_len = (size_t) data_chunk_size; in mac_test_run_pkey() 1998 size_t current_len = (size_t) data_chunk_size; in mac_test_run_mac() 3187 size_t current_len = (size_t) data_chunk_size; in encode_test_run() 3219 size_t current_len = (size_t) data_chunk_size; in encode_test_run() [all …]
|
/openssl/engines/ |
H A D | e_dasync.c | 72 size_t count); 120 size_t inlen); 124 size_t inlen); 159 size_t inl); 167 size_t *lens; 611 size_t count) in dasync_sha1_update() 663 pipe_ctx->lens = (size_t *)ptr; in dasync_cipher_ctrl_helper() 955 size_t inlen) in dasync_rsa_encrypt() 959 size_t inlen); in dasync_rsa_encrypt() 977 size_t inlen) in dasync_rsa_decrypt() [all …]
|
/openssl/providers/implementations/signature/ |
H A D | dsa_sig.c | 102 size_t aid_len; 111 size_t siglen; 124 return (size_t)md_size; in dsa_get_md_size() 162 size_t mdname_len = strlen(mdname); in dsa_setup_md() 326 unsigned char *sig, size_t *siglen, size_t sigsize, in dsa_sign_directly() 332 size_t dsasize = DSA_size(pdsactx->dsa); in dsa_sign_directly() 333 size_t mdsize = dsa_get_md_size(pdsactx); in dsa_sign_directly() 377 size_t *siglen, size_t sigsize) in dsa_sign_message_final() 408 size_t sigsize, const unsigned char *tbs, size_t tbslen) in dsa_sign() 566 size_t *siglen, size_t sigsize) in dsa_digest_sign_final() [all …]
|
H A D | ecdsa_sig.c | 99 size_t aid_len; 105 size_t mdsize; 109 size_t siglen; 172 size_t mdname_len; in ecdsa_setup_md() 250 ctx->mdsize = (size_t)md_size; in ecdsa_setup_md() 313 unsigned char *sig, size_t *siglen, size_t sigsize, in ecdsa_sign_directly() 319 size_t ecsize = ECDSA_size(ctx->ec); in ecdsa_sign_directly() 334 if (sigsize < (size_t)ecsize) in ecdsa_sign_directly() 373 size_t *siglen, size_t sigsize) in ecdsa_sign_message_final() 398 size_t sigsize, const unsigned char *tbs, size_t tbslen) in ecdsa_sign() [all …]
|
/openssl/include/crypto/ |
H A D | poly1305.h | 23 size_t len, unsigned int padbit); 34 size_t num; 41 size_t Poly1305_ctx_size(void); 43 void Poly1305_Update(POLY1305 *ctx, const unsigned char *inp, size_t len);
|
H A D | des_platform.h | 23 void des_t4_ede3_cbc_encrypt(const void *inp, void *out, size_t len, 25 void des_t4_ede3_cbc_decrypt(const void *inp, void *out, size_t len, 27 void des_t4_cbc_encrypt(const void *inp, void *out, size_t len, 29 void des_t4_cbc_decrypt(const void *inp, void *out, size_t len,
|
/openssl/fuzz/ |
H A D | dtlsserver.c | 588 int FuzzerTestOneInput(const uint8_t *buf, size_t len) in FuzzerTestOneInput() 629 …OPENSSL_assert((size_t)BIO_write(bio_buf, RSAPrivateKeyPEM, sizeof(RSAPrivateKeyPEM)) == sizeof(RS… in FuzzerTestOneInput() 642 …OPENSSL_assert((size_t)BIO_write(bio_buf, RSACertificatePEM, sizeof(RSACertificatePEM)) == sizeof(… in FuzzerTestOneInput() 654 …OPENSSL_assert((size_t)BIO_write(bio_buf, ECDSAPrivateKeyPEM, sizeof(ECDSAPrivateKeyPEM)) == sizeo… in FuzzerTestOneInput() 666 …OPENSSL_assert((size_t)BIO_write(bio_buf, ECDSACertPEM, sizeof(ECDSACertPEM)) == sizeof(ECDSACertP… in FuzzerTestOneInput() 678 …OPENSSL_assert((size_t)BIO_write(bio_buf, DSAPrivateKeyPEM, sizeof(DSAPrivateKeyPEM)) == sizeof(DS… in FuzzerTestOneInput() 690 … OPENSSL_assert((size_t)BIO_write(bio_buf, DSACertPEM, sizeof(DSACertPEM)) == sizeof(DSACertPEM)); in FuzzerTestOneInput() 705 OPENSSL_assert((size_t)BIO_write(in, buf, len) == len); in FuzzerTestOneInput()
|
/openssl/providers/implementations/macs/ |
H A D | siphash_prov.c | 88 static size_t siphash_size(void *vmacctx) in siphash_size() 96 const unsigned char *key, size_t keylen) in siphash_setkey() 108 static int siphash_init(void *vmacctx, const unsigned char *key, size_t keylen, in siphash_init() 127 size_t datalen) in siphash_update() 138 static int siphash_final(void *vmacctx, unsigned char *out, size_t *outl, in siphash_final() 139 size_t outsize) in siphash_final() 142 size_t hlen = siphash_size(ctx); in siphash_final() 199 size_t size; in siphash_set_params()
|
/openssl/demos/signature/ |
H A D | EVP_ED_Signature_demo.c | 29 const unsigned char *tbs, size_t tbs_len, in demo_sign() 32 size_t *sig_out_len) in demo_sign() 35 size_t sig_len; in demo_sign() 88 const unsigned char *tbs, size_t tbs_len, in demo_verify() 89 const unsigned char *sig_value, size_t sig_len, in demo_verify() 133 size_t pubdata_len = 0; in create_key() 173 size_t sig_len = 0; in main()
|
/openssl/include/internal/ |
H A D | quic_tserver.h | 45 size_t alpnlen; 96 size_t buf_len, 97 size_t *bytes_read); 118 size_t buf_len, 119 size_t *bytes_written); 194 const void *buf, size_t len,
|
/openssl/include/openssl/ |
H A D | ec.h | 303 size_t EC_GROUP_get_seed_len(const EC_GROUP *); 304 size_t EC_GROUP_set_seed(EC_GROUP *, const unsigned char *, size_t len); 548 size_t EC_get_builtin_curves(EC_builtin_curve *r, size_t nitems); 760 size_t EC_POINT_point2oct(const EC_GROUP *group, const EC_POINT *p, 879 const BIGNUM *n, size_t num, 1152 OSSL_DEPRECATEDIN_3_0 size_t EC_KEY_key2buf(const EC_KEY *key, 1165 size_t len, BN_CTX *ctx); 1175 size_t len); 1185 OSSL_DEPRECATEDIN_3_0 size_t EC_KEY_priv2oct(const EC_KEY *key, 1193 OSSL_DEPRECATEDIN_3_0 size_t EC_KEY_priv2buf(const EC_KEY *eckey, [all …]
|
/openssl/ssl/quic/ |
H A D | quic_wire_pkt.c | 19 size_t quic_hp_key_len) in ossl_quic_hdr_protector_init() 83 size_t i; in hdr_generate_mask() 194 size_t l = PACKET_remaining(pkt); in ossl_quic_wire_decode_pkt_hdr() 375 hdr->token_len = (size_t)token_len; in ossl_quic_wire_decode_pkt_hdr() 463 size_t off_start, off_sample, off_pn; in ossl_quic_wire_encode_pkt_hdr() 596 size_t len = 0, enclen; in ossl_quic_wire_get_encoded_pkt_hdr_len() 661 size_t blen; in ossl_quic_wire_get_pkt_hdr_dst_conn_id() 682 blen = (size_t)buf[5]; /* DCID Length */ in ossl_quic_wire_get_pkt_hdr_dst_conn_id() 706 size_t enc_pn_len, in ossl_quic_wire_decode_pkt_hdr_pn() 774 size_t enc_pn_len) in ossl_quic_wire_encode_pkt_hdr_pn() [all …]
|
H A D | qlog_event_helpers.c | 207 size_t *need_skip) in log_frame_actual() 213 size_t i; in log_frame_actual() 298 *need_skip += (size_t)f.len; in log_frame_actual() 481 size_t token_len; in log_frame_actual() 516 size_t *need_skip) in log_frame() 518 size_t rem_before, rem_after; in log_frame() 531 size_t num_iovec) in log_frames() 533 size_t i; in log_frames() 535 size_t need_skip = 0; in log_frames() 543 size_t adv = need_skip; in log_frames() [all …]
|
/openssl/ssl/statem/ |
H A D | extensions_cust.c | 34 size_t *outlen, X509 *x, size_t chainidx, in custom_ext_add_old_cb_wrap() 61 size_t inlen, X509 *x, size_t chainidx, in custom_ext_parse_old_cb_wrap() 83 size_t *idx) in custom_ext_find() 85 size_t i; in custom_ext_find() 105 size_t i; in custom_ext_init() 116 size_t chainidx) in custom_ext_parse() 179 size_t i; in custom_ext_add() 185 size_t outlen = 0; in custom_ext_add() 265 size_t i; in custom_exts_copy_flags() 284 size_t i; in custom_exts_copy() [all …]
|
/openssl/providers/implementations/kdfs/ |
H A D | kbkdf.c | 66 size_t ki_len; 68 size_t label_len; 70 size_t context_len; 72 size_t iv_len; 208 size_t iv_len, unsigned char *label, size_t label_len, in derive() 209 unsigned char *context, size_t context_len, in derive() 211 unsigned char *ko, size_t ko_len, int r) in derive() 215 size_t written = 0, to_write, k_i_len = iv_len; in derive() 282 const unsigned char *context, size_t contextlen) in kmac_derive() 293 static int kbkdf_derive(void *vctx, unsigned char *key, size_t keylen, in kbkdf_derive() [all …]
|
/openssl/crypto/ec/ |
H A D | ec_pmeth.c | 42 size_t kdf_ukmlen; 44 size_t kdf_outlen; 105 const unsigned char *tbs, size_t tbslen) in pkey_ec_sign() 123 *siglen = (size_t)sig_sz; in pkey_ec_sign() 127 if (*siglen < (size_t)sig_sz) { in pkey_ec_sign() 138 *siglen = (size_t)sltmp; in pkey_ec_sign() 143 const unsigned char *sig, size_t siglen, in pkey_ec_verify() 169 size_t outlen; in pkey_ec_derive() 214 unsigned char *key, size_t *keylen) in pkey_ec_kdf_derive() 218 size_t ktmplen; in pkey_ec_kdf_derive() [all …]
|